Preparation Guide for the Position of Assistant Manager / Manager (Manufacturing Industry) at Moving Machines Limited
1. Understand the Company and Its Market
- Company Profile: Moving Machines Limited (MML) is a private engineering firm founded in 2014, offering equipment such as welders, generators, air compressors, sheet‑pile drivers and bulldozers. The company places strong emphasis on after‑sales service.
- Industry Focus: Construction and manufacturing sectors in Bangladesh.
- Key Products to Sell: Generators, cranes, forklifts, air compressors, sheet‑pile drivers, bulldozers, welding machines.
- Geographical Scope: Nationwide sales and client visits; head office in Mohakhali DOHS, Dhaka.

3. Tailor Your Application Documents
Resume
- Use a clear, chronological format.
- Start with a “Professional Summary” that mentions 5‑+ years of experience in industrial equipment sales and leadership.
- Include a “Key Achievements” section with quantifiable results (e.g., “Increased generator sales by 30 % YoY, achieving BD 5 million revenue in FY 2023”).
- List technical skills, software tools (CRM, MS Office, SAP), and language proficiency.
Cover Letter
- Address it to the HR/Recruitment Manager at MML.
- Open with a strong statement about your enthusiasm for the role and the company’s mission of delivering cutting‑edge engineering solutions.
- Briefly describe three of your most relevant achievements that align with the responsibilities (client acquisition, sales strategy, market expansion).
- Conclude by stating your willingness to travel nationwide and your confidence in contributing to MML’s growth.
Supporting Documents
- Copy of academic certificates or transcripts.
- Professional certifications (e.g., Certified Maintenance & Reliability Professional, Project Management Professional).
- Letters of recommendation/endorsement from previous employers or key clients.

5. Prepare for the Interview
Common Question Themes
1. Experience & Achievements
- Explain a situation where you identified a new market segment and converted it into sales.
- Describe how you achieved a difficult sales target; include numbers and tactics.
2. Technical Competence
- Discuss how you would evaluate a client’s need for a specific generator size or crane capacity.
- Explain the maintenance considerations you would highlight during product demonstrations.
3. Client Relationship Management
- Share an example of turning a dissatisfied client into a long‑term partner.
4. Strategic Planning
- Outline a three‑month sales plan for launching a new forklift model in Bangladesh.
5. Networking & Market Knowledge
- Talk about key industry contacts you have and how they could be engaged for MML.
6. Cultural Fit & Leadership
- Provide examples of leading a cross‑functional team (sales, engineering, service) to meet a project deadline.
Practical Preparation
- Mock Presentation: Prepare a 10‑minute pitch for a flagship product (e.g., a diesel generator). Include market need, technical advantages, ROI for the client, and after‑sales service plan.
- Site‑Visit Simulation: Be ready to discuss how you conduct a client’s plant tour, identify equipment gaps, and propose solutions on the spot.
- Travel Logistics: Have a clear plan showing your ability to travel extensively (e.g., transport arrangements, regional familiarity).
